**Job Title**:Assistant Manager, Strategic Planning and Development Unit**
**Business Entity**: National Programme for Cardiovascular Research
**Overview**
The Consortium for Clinical Research and Innovation, Singapore (CRIS) brings together five national R&D,
clinical translation and service programmes to advance clinical research and innovation for Singapore, and
establish important capabilities for a future-ready healthcare system.
The Business Entities under CRIS include:
Singapore Clinical Research Institute (SCRI)
National Health Innovation Centre (NHIC)
Advanced Cell Therapy and Research Institute, Singapore (ACTRIS)
Precision Health Research, Singapore (PRECISE)
Singapore Translational Cancer Consortium (STCC)
Together, CRIS makes a positive difference to Singapore patients and researchers by ensuring that these
clinical research platforms and programmes are at the cutting edge of capability development and innovation.
If you are as passionate as we are in clinical trials and research, we want you
The National Programme for Cardiovascular Research aims to strengthen the overall impact of
cardiovascular research and translation in Singapore by bringing together key basic, clinical and translational
teams in joint platforms to actively establish and implement collaborative cardiovascular research
programmes involving different organisation and research partners (MOHT, NHCS & NHRIS, NUHCS &
CVRI, NHG Heart Institute, KTPH, A*STAR, NUS, Duke-NUS, LKC).
**What you will be working on**
**(A) GENERAL
Working under the supervision of the Executive Director of this National Programme, the incumbent
will be responsible for:
1. Supporting the Programme’s clinical and research partners in the implementation of strategic
cardiovascular programmes across institutions and agencies.
2. Initiating and managing Programme-related activities, events, meetings or initiatives with industry
partners, public institutions, and private sectors.
3. Working cross-functionally across the different internal departments (legal, finance, HR, corporate
communications, IT) and with the different Programme partner institutions to establish the
successful set-up of platforms and programmes.
4. Convening the board and executive committee meetings, setting the agenda and providing
secretariat support at various meeting platforms.
5. Working with the Programme partners to develop new grant proposals and to administer and
monitor the allocated Programme budget.
6. Managing the administration and day-to-day operations of the Programme.
7. Tracking the progress and deliverables of the Programme including budget, milestones and
deliverables.
8. Supporting the progress reporting of the Programme to the relevant agencies, institutions and
funding bodies.
**What we are looking for**
**(A) EDUCATION, TRAINING**
Degree or Masters in health & biological sciences or related discipline; a PhD is not essential but will
be an advantage.
**(B) EXPERIENCE**
1. At least 5 years of experience in the R&D and/or Healthcare sector.
2. Knowledge of clinical trials and cardiology/cardiovascular biology research would be preferred, but
not necessary.
3. Familiarity with the healthcare biomedical landscape and experience with research/clinical
collaborations and commercialization.
**(C) ATTRIBUTES
1. Project/programme management skills and able to work effectively in a cross-functional matrix.
2. Excellent communication (written and oral) and interpersonal skills.
3. Resourceful and able to work independently and in a team with mínimal supervision.
4. Good analytical and effective problem-solving skills.
5. Strong organisational/administrative skills and attention to details.
6. Self-starter, proactive and results oriented.
7. Excellent Microsoft office skills including power-point, excel, word etc.
